Optimization of Image Classification for CIFAR-10 dataset

Experiment

  • Defined a CNN for classification of CIFAR-10 dataset
  • Studied the influence of data augmentation
  • Studied the influence of 2 different optimization algorithms - sgd and adam
  • Studied the influence of 3 loss functions - cross-entropy, hinge loss, hinge squared loss

Setup

I used google cloud platform, which I personally felt very user-friendly. To setup google instance and GPU, I followed the instruction from standford cs231n. I used NVIDIA Tesla K80 GPU. See reports for details. http://cs231n.github.io/gce-tutorial/ http://cs231n.github.io/gce-tutorial-gpus/

Libraries

  • Keras 1.20 (Note newer version will cause errors.)
  • Tensorflow
